Output ae8db84049be84550865ba65d4785224dc1d6917931888437ea8b80a6ac951fa:1

value
12599060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7add0014143d6192372e6907a8081af02b67f343 OP_EQUAL
address
3Ctf7KNVWGgMjQexMpbMYu88Q94KX9yfXP
transaction
ae8db84049be84550865ba65d4785224dc1d6917931888437ea8b80a6ac951fa
spent
true